Cathy Duffy has been reviewing homeschool curriculum and resources since the s, and is the author of several books, including her most recent volume, Top Picks for Homeschool Curriculum. Cathy began educating her three sons at home in and continued all the way through high school. In addition to teaching her own sons, she has taught numerous group classes for home-educated students and church groups.

Technological innovations in homeschool curriculum and the many new publishers entering the market provide homeschoolers with more choices than ever. In Top Picks for Homeschool Curriculum , Cathy highlights the best products among the thousands available in this rapidly expanding homeschool marketplace. The first part of this book helps homeschoolers learn how to select curriculum. Cathy simplifies the curriculum selection process with questionnaires and charts. She walks her readers through the process of figuring out their preferences in terms of approaches to education, learning styles, and goal setting. Armed with that knowledge, homeschooling parents can use the charts in the book to identify which of the Top Picks are most likely to suit their children.

It includes extensive reviews of each of her Top Picks. Selecting the right curriculum can be a time consuming, heart-wrenching task for any family that chooses home education.
